Quran,Translation and Commentary in Brief (Vol. 01)
OCCASION OF REVELATION (VERSE NO. 232) Verse 233

      In the Pagan Era, women were in the chain of man's captivity, and were treated according to man's caprice and selfishness. In choosing a husband, she had no right to decide! She could be married with the permission of her guardian, and if she was divorced, and then decided to join her husband in reconciliation, she could only do so, with the help and permission of her father, brother, or other guardians. Many a time it happened that the couple separated through a divorce and yet they loved each other, and when they repented and wantd to reconcile and save their tie of wedlock, a man from the family - either a brother or a father prevented her to rejoin her husband. Therefore this verse came down to obliterate such unfair customs saying: ``Do not prevent them from marrying their former husband if they come to a fair and mutual agreement.''

      The verse then gives a warning that this is: ``An admonition for those of you who believe in Allah and the Last Day.'' And in order to put an emphasis on the matter it ends in saying: ``It is cleaner and purer for you. Allah knows and you know not.'' In other word: ``These commandments are for your own good, but only those from among you will fulfil, that believe in God, and in the Last Day.''
